So, even as Diamond becomes the prime suspect in this tragedy (the murder weapon was an old revolver he'd secreted in his attic), he pursues more probable perpetrators--including a local gangster clan and Stephanie's ex-husband, a ne'er-do-well chef who might also be connected with an elaborate jewel-theft scheme and the recent disappearance of another cop's wife. Lovesey created two historical series before tackling the Diamond books, and his experience shows here as he carefully weaves together profuse plot threads, while simultaneously (and convincingly) forcing his protagonist's evolution through misfortune. That he succeeds in making the testy-before-his-time Peter Diamond an endearing figure is, alone, credit to Lovesey's authorial aptitude. Diamond Dust fans should hunt up previous installments of this witty series, especially Bloodhounds and The Vault. --J. Kingston Pierce
Detective Superintendent Peter Diamond is confronted with a crime that comes too close to home. His beloved wife has been killed, apparently just the most recent victim in a series of murders of police spouses. Despite his superior's orders to leave the solution of this crime to other members of the force, he is determined to find the killer himself.
Peter Lovesey, author of five previous Peter Diamond mysteries, has been awarded the British Crime Writers Association Gold, Silver, and Diamond Daggers, as well as many U.S. honors. He lives in West Sussex, England.
